IRS Issues Another Set of Final Foreign Tax Credit Rules

December 28, 2021, 9:22 PM UTC

Multinationals now have final rules that tell them how to calculate their foreign tax credits.

The IRS released the rules (TD 9959; RIN: 1545-BP70) Tuesday.

  • The final rules tell companies how to allocate expenses, including business and R&D spending, and which foreign taxes may be claimed in credits.
  • The proposed rules, issued in October 2020, said companies subject to measures like digital services taxes abroad probably won’t be able to receive U.S. credits for those taxes. The agency issued a separate package of final rules at that time.
